Additional M300C features include:
- 1920 x 1080P full high-definition output with stunning day and night-time video
- Pan and tilt gimbal system for 360-degree visibility and slew-to-cue integration with leading electronics
- 30X optical zoom, and a 12X digital zoom beyond that for outstanding long-range capability
- Wide-angle 63-degree to ultra-narrow 2.3-degree adjustable field-of view
- Two-axis gyro stabilization for steady viewing in rough seas, even when zoomed
- Digital video-over-ethernet, analog and lossless HD-SDI video outputs
- Easy integration with marine electronics from Garmin, Furuno, Raymarine and Simrad displays.
- Extensively tested for waterproof, shock, vibration, EMC and lightning protection

About Teledyne FLIR
Teledyne FLIR, a subsidiary of Teledyne Technologies, stands as a global frontrunner in intelligent sensing, unmanned systems, and comprehensive solutions for defense and industrial sectors, boasting approximately 4,000 employees across the globe. Established in 1978, the company pioneers a diverse array of cutting-edge technologies aimed at empowering professionals to make swift, informed decisions that safeguard both lives and livelihoods.
